Sudbury Airport
Sudbury Airport (MA70) is a general-aviation airfield serving Sudbury, Massachusetts. The field lies at 135 ft (41 m) above sea level and has a single runway of 1,000 ft (305 m), grass. Its nearest neighbour is Kallander Field (09MA), 4 nm SW.
